The red wine Quinta do Valdoeiro is a blend of Syrah, Baga, Touriga Nacional, and Cabernet Sauvignon. After 18 months of aging in French oak barrels it offers an intense, fresh, Atlantic‑inspired aroma, highlighting iodine‑infused notes, dark fruit, and a subtle vegetal nuance. On the palate it is refined and food‑friendly. Located in the parish of Vacariça, in the municipality of Mealhada, the Quinta do Valdoeiro was acquired by the Messias family in the 1940s. From 1985 onward, Messias—already making raw‑material control a key strategy for producing high‑quality wines—gradually converted the vineyard plots at Quinta do Valdoeiro. Today the estate covers 130 hectares, of which 70 hectares are devoted to viticulture. The property lies within an integrated protection zone, where vineyard pests are managed through environmentally safe methods. (Illustrative image only)
